QuickBooks is one of the most widely used accounting platforms for small and medium-sized businesses. It’s fast, reliable, and built to simplify your bookkeeping, payroll, and financial reporting. But when it comes to inventory management, QuickBooks alone can feel limited—especially if your business deals with large product catalogs, multiple warehouses, or complex stock movements.
That’s where a QuickBooks inventory software like GOIS (Goods Order Inventory System) becomes essential. By integrating GOIS with QuickBooks, you create a seamless bridge between your accounting and your inventory operations. This means fewer manual updates, fewer errors, and a single source of truth for your entire business.
| According to Procurement Tactics, 43% of small business owners lose money due to poor inventory tracking, mostly because they rely on manual systems or non-integrated tools. This is exactly the problem GOIS solves. |
The QuickBooks POS Discontinuation — A Growing Concern
In 2023, Intuit officially discontinued its QuickBooks Point of Sale (POS) system. For many small and mid-sized retailers, this left a major gap in daily operations—especially for those who relied on POS to manage in-store sales, inventory counts, and customer transactions. Without a replacement, businesses are now facing challenges such as:
- Manual sales entry into QuickBooks after each transaction
- Delayed inventory updates, leading to stockouts or overstocking
- Loss of integrated reporting between sales and accounting
- Extra time spent reconciling orders at the end of the day
The good news? Integrating QuickBooks with an inventory solution that includes POS capabilities—like GOIS – solves this problem immediately.
GOIS offers a built-in POS module that works both online and offline, automatically syncing sales data, updating inventory counts in real time, and pushing financial data to QuickBooks without manual input. This means you can process sales, manage returns, and track customer purchases without losing the automation you had in QuickBooks POS.
| Navigating the Transition: Migrating from QuickBooks POS to GOIS – Read More |
Understanding QuickBooks Inventory Management
QuickBooks offers basic inventory management features designed to help small and medium-sized businesses track their stock levels, manage purchase orders, and generate reports. While not as robust as dedicated inventory management software, QuickBooks can be a valuable tool for businesses with relatively simple inventory needs.
Core Features of QuickBooks Inventory Software

- Item Tracking: QuickBooks allows you to create and manage a list of inventory items, each with its own description, cost, and sales price. You can categorize items for better organization and reporting.
- Purchase Orders: You can create and track purchase orders to manage your procurement process. QuickBooks allows you to record when items are ordered, received, and paid for.
- Sales Orders: Similar to purchase orders, you can create and track sales orders to manage customer orders. This helps you keep track of what needs to be shipped and invoiced.
- Inventory Adjustments: QuickBooks allows you to make adjustments to your inventory levels to account for spoilage, theft, or other discrepancies.
- Inventory Reports: QuickBooks provides a variety of reports that can help you track your inventory levels, sales, and costs. These reports can be used to make informed decisions about purchasing and pricing.
- Cost of Goods Sold (COGS) Tracking: QuickBooks automatically calculates and tracks your COGS, which is an important metric for understanding your profitability.
- Inventory Valuation Methods: QuickBooks supports different inventory valuation methods, such as FIFO (First-In, First-Out) and Average Cost.
Limitations of QuickBooks Inventory Software
While QuickBooks offers useful inventory management features, it also has limitations that can hinder businesses with more complex needs:
- Limited Scalability: As your business grows and your inventory becomes more complex, QuickBooks may not be able to keep up.
- Lack of Advanced Features: QuickBooks lacks advanced features such as barcode scanning, lot tracking, and warehouse management.
- Manual Data Entry: QuickBooks often requires manual data entry, which can be time-consuming and prone to errors.
- Limited User Access Control: QuickBooks may not offer the granular user access control needed to protect sensitive inventory data.
- Reporting Limitations: While QuickBooks offers a variety of reports, they may not be customizable enough to meet the specific needs of your business.
- No Real-Time Inventory Visibility: QuickBooks may not provide real-time visibility into your inventory levels, which can lead to stockouts or overstocking.
Optimizing QuickBooks for Inventory Management
Despite its limitations, QuickBooks can be optimized for more effective inventory management. Here are some strategies:

- Accurate Item Setup: Ensure that all inventory items are set up correctly with accurate descriptions, costs, and sales prices.
- Regular Inventory Audits: Conduct regular physical inventory counts to verify the accuracy of your inventory data.
- Utilize Inventory Reports: Regularly review inventory reports to identify trends, track sales, and make informed decisions about purchasing and pricing.
- Implement a Barcode System: Consider implementing a barcode system to streamline data entry and improve accuracy. While QuickBooks doesn’t natively support advanced barcode scanning, third-party integrations can bridge this gap.
- Train Your Staff: Ensure that your staff is properly trained on how to use QuickBooks for inventory management.
- Use Inventory Adjustments Wisely: Use inventory adjustments to account for discrepancies, but be sure to investigate the root cause of the discrepancies to prevent them from happening again.
- Choose the Right Inventory Valuation Method: Select the inventory valuation method that best suits your business and industry.
- Regularly Update QuickBooks: Keep your QuickBooks software up to date to ensure that you have the latest features and security updates.
When to Consider a Dedicated Inventory Management Software
For businesses experiencing the limitations of QuickBooks inventory software, a dedicated inventory management solution may be necessary. Here are some signs that it’s time to upgrade:
| Top 10 Inventory Management Systems to Watch Out For in 2025 – Read More |
- Growing Inventory Complexity: If your inventory has become too complex for QuickBooks to handle, a dedicated solution can provide the advanced features you need.
- Frequent Stockouts or Overstocking: If you’re experiencing frequent stockouts or overstocking, a dedicated solution can help you improve your inventory forecasting and planning.
- Inefficient Inventory Processes: If your inventory processes are inefficient and time-consuming, a dedicated solution can help you automate tasks and streamline workflows.
- Lack of Real-Time Visibility: If you need real-time visibility into your inventory levels, a dedicated solution can provide the insights you need.
- Multiple Warehouses or Locations: If you have multiple warehouses or locations, a dedicated solution can help you manage your inventory across all locations.
- Integration with Other Systems: If you need to integrate your inventory management system with other systems, such as your e-commerce platform or CRM, a dedicated solution can provide the necessary integrations.
Integrating QuickBooks with Inventory Management Software
Many dedicated inventory management software offer seamless integration with QuickBooks. This allows you to leverage the accounting capabilities of QuickBooks while benefiting from the advanced inventory management features of a specialized solution.
Benefits of Integration
- Improved Accuracy: Integration eliminates the need for manual data entry, reducing the risk of errors.
- Increased Efficiency: Integration automates tasks and streamlines workflows, saving time and improving efficiency.
- Real-Time Visibility: Integration provides real-time visibility into your inventory levels and financial data.
- Better Decision-Making: Integration provides the data you need to make informed decisions about purchasing, pricing, and inventory management.
- Reduced Costs: Integration can help you reduce costs by improving inventory control and reducing waste.
Popular QuickBooks Inventory Management Integrations
Choosing the right QuickBooks inventory software integration can make or break how efficiently your business tracks stock, processes orders, and syncs financial data. Below are some popular solutions that integrate seamlessly with QuickBooks, each offering unique benefits depending on your business model.
1. GOIS (Goods Order Inventory System)
GOIS is an easy-to-use, affordable QuickBooks inventory software option built for small and growing businesses. It’s designed to simplify stock control, purchase management, and order fulfillment without the steep learning curve of complex ERP systems. GOIS integrates with QuickBooks to keep your inventory data in sync with your accounting, so every sale, return, or purchase order automatically updates your books. It’s especially valuable for businesses that want cloud access, real-time reporting, and multi-location tracking—all without breaking the budget.
QuickBooks vs. QuickBooks + GOIS: Feature Comparison
| Feature | QuickBooks Inventory Software Alone | QuickBooks + GOIS |
|---|---|---|
| Basic inventory tracking | Available | Available |
| Multi-location tracking | Limited or Enterprise only | Full support |
| Barcode & lot/serial tracking | Not available | Supported |
| Manufacturing workflows (BOM, Kitting) | Not supported | Built-in |
| Automated reordering | Manual alerts | Fully automated |
| Advanced reporting & forecasting | Basic | Comprehensive |
2. Fishbowl Inventory
Fishbowl is a robust manufacturing and warehouse management solution designed for businesses that require advanced inventory control. It offers features like barcode scanning, part tracking, and work order management. Its integration with QuickBooks helps ensure that all inventory transactions—purchases, sales, adjustments—are automatically reflected in your accounting system, reducing manual data entry and minimizing errors.
3. QuickBooks Commerce
TradeGecko, rebranded as QuickBooks Commerce, is tailored for e-commerce businesses that sell across multiple platforms. It allows users to manage orders, track products, and oversee multiple sales channels from one dashboard. The QuickBooks integration ensures that every sale is accounted for in real time, giving you accurate profit margins and financial statements without extra admin work.
4.Cin7
Cin7 is a cloud-based inventory management platform ideal for omnichannel retailers. It provides features like built-in POS (Point of Sale), automated order routing, and integration with over 700 third-party platforms. When paired with QuickBooks, Cin7 ensures your inventory costs, stock movements, and revenue data are updated instantly, helping you maintain precise records for better decision-making.
5. Zoho Inventory
Zoho Inventory is another cloud-based solution that integrates seamlessly with the Zoho ecosystem and QuickBooks. It’s best suited for small to mid-sized businesses needing a simple yet powerful inventory tracking tool. Zoho Inventory allows you to track shipments, manage warehouses, and automate order workflows while syncing financial data directly to QuickBooks for clean and organized accounting.
Final Thoughts
QuickBooks is excellent for managing your finances, but for growing businesses, it needs a powerful inventory partner. GOIS fills that gap with advanced tracking, real-time sync, and robust reporting — all while keeping your accounting in perfect order.
Ready to upgrade your QuickBooks inventory management?
👉 Try GOIS with QuickBooks Today and take full control of your stock.
Frequently Answered Questions (FAQ’s)
1. What is QuickBooks inventory software?
QuickBooks inventory software refers to tools and systems that integrate with QuickBooks to help businesses track stock levels, manage orders, update accounting records automatically, and streamline inventory processes. It ensures that both your financial and inventory data stay accurate and in sync.
2. Why should I integrate my inventory management system with QuickBooks?
Integrating your inventory system with QuickBooks eliminates manual data entry, reduces errors, and keeps your financials updated in real time. This means sales, purchase orders, and stock adjustments automatically reflect in your accounting records, saving time and improving accuracy.
3. How does GOIS work with QuickBooks for inventory tracking?
GOIS (Goods Order Inventory System) connects directly to QuickBooks, allowing you to manage products, track stock across locations, handle purchase and sales orders, and instantly push updates to your accounting records. This integration helps small and medium businesses maintain real-time inventory accuracy while simplifying bookkeeping.
4. Can QuickBooks inventory software work for multiple locations?
Yes—many QuickBooks-compatible inventory systems, including GOIS, offer multi-location tracking. You can monitor stock in different warehouses or stores, transfer items between locations, and view consolidated reports for better decision-making.
5. Is QuickBooks inventory integration suitable for small businesses?
Absolutely. While large companies benefit from the automation, small businesses gain the most value because integration saves hours of manual work, improves order accuracy, and gives a clearer financial picture without hiring extra staff.